Title
Hochtechnologie und Außenhandel. Die Bedeutung forschungsintensiver Güter für den Außenhandel der OECD-Staaten
Abstract
Nowadays, the external trade of industrialized countries is dominated by technology-intensive products. There is, however, a considerable discrepancy between empirical findings and their theoretical explanation. Therefore the study focusses on the teoretical work of economic theory which helps to explain these phenomena. A general distinction is made between neoclassical and evolutionary approaches, each of them discussed from the perspectives of growth teory and international trade. The review reveals the great progress economic theory has went through during the last decade but also points to the still existing indadequacies in theory. The last section tries to connect contemporary theory to well-developed empirical research-methods.
